Step 1
Wash Greens well
Step 2
Place on to dehydrator trays, they can overlap
Step 3
Dry at 95F / 35C for best nutrient retention, but 125F/52C is the 'standard' temp
Step 4
Test for dryness - should completely crumble in your hand
Step 5
Condition
Step 6
Store in an airtight container
Step 7
Place greens in the grinder / blender of your choice
Step 8
Process until a smooth green powder is made
Step 9
Store in an airtight container for up to a year.
